Global Air Conditioner Industry is progressing at a constant pace, due to improving cooling technology, growing urban population, and the need for energy-efficient air conditioning systems. The construction activities, mainly in the developing countries, are growing rapidly affecting the demand for air conditioners in residential, commercial, and industrial sectors. Besides, environmental awareness is increasing and is the main reason for the change in consumer preference towards using eco-friendly refrigerants and energy-efficient models.

Global AC Market size is projected to grow at a CAGR of 6.5% during the forecast period (2026–2032). Market is mainly driven by factors like the increasing consumer need for cooling solutions as a result of the global warming, the innovations in energy-efficient systems and the rising concern over sustainability and the use of eco-friendly refrigerants. Furthermore, the continual Global AC Market Growth is also supported by the increasing air conditioner demand in the developing countries, mainly caused by urbanization and the expansion of the middle-class. Moreover, the market is being positively affected by the government rules that are in favor of green technologies and the use of sustainable cooling solutions.

Global AC Market faces several hurdles that comes in the form of high initial installation costs, the limited awareness of energy-efficient models in emerging markets, and the environmental impact of traditional refrigerants. Moreover, heating, ventilation, and air conditioning (HVAC) is a competitive market due to the competition from other technologies, like evaporative coolers and cool roofs. On top of that, there are rules regarding refrigerant use that need to be navigated and ongoing developments in energy-efficient systems are continuously bringing about significant barriers.

Government initiatives are key drivers of growth in the Global AC Market. The U.S. Department of Energy’s Efficiency Standards Program, encouraging the incorporation of energy efficient air conditioning systems, is one such example. The National Cooling Action Plan (NCAP) of India supports the adoption of energy-efficient air conditioners and the development of alternative refrigerants, encouraging sustainable cooling. To reduce the carbon footprint of cooling systems and promote the use of environmentally friendly refrigerants these initiatives are developed.

Export potential enables firms to identify high-growth global markets with greater confidence by combining advanced trade intelligence with a structured quantitative methodology. The framework analyzes emerging demand trends and country-level import patterns while integrating macroeconomic and trade datasets such as GDP and population forecasts, bilateral import–export flows, tariff structures, elasticity differentials between developed and developing economies, geographic distance, and import demand projections. Using weighted trade values from 2020–2024 as the base period to project country-to-country export potential for 2030, these inputs are operationalized through calculated drivers such as gravity model parameters, tariff impact factors, and projected GDP per-capita growth. Through an analysis of hidden potentials, demand hotspots, and market conditions that are most favorable to success, this method enables firms to focus on target countries, maximize returns, and global expansion with data, backed by accuracy.
By factoring in the projected importer demand gap that is currently unmet and could be potential opportunity, it identifies the potential for the Exporter (Country) among 190 countries, against the general trade analysis, which identifies the biggest importer or exporter.
